It End With Violence is the third book in the Saint View Psychos and to be completely honest I didn't like it was much as I thought I would. It actually made me a bit annoyed.
Overall, I really did like the relationship between War, Vincent/Scythe and Bliss. It was wholesome and really entertaining to read about. But I have no clue what Nash's purpose was in this story. He is one of those annoying MCs that are just there and don't really serve the plot in any way. Yes, him and Bliss have sexual attraction, but other than that he was unnecessary.
I was also a bit disappointed in how Bliss is portrayed in this book. While I do understand that there had do be some character development, she doesn't seem the kind of person that would go around and do stupid things that cost her so much. Also, there didn't need to be that much sex going on. I would prefer to have the characters go around and try to solve the mystery, because at some point even that gets boring.
Overall, this is a decent series. I won't be rereading it, but if you want a quick read with a lot of spice and little plot, then this one is for you.
